REMOVAL OF LAMPS
Turn gas and electricity mains off
1. Remove cabinet side panel as described in REMOVAL OF CONTROL CABINET
PANELS.
2. Disconnect the lamps flying leads.
3. Undo and remove the retaining collar.
4. Remove the 2 nuts retaining the light mount and spacer.
5. Withdraw the lamp from the control compartment.
6. Replace in reverse order.
REMOVAL OF CLASSIC/ADVANCED CONTROLLER
Turn gas and electricity mains off
To Replace:
1. Remove cabinet side panels as described in REMOVAL OF CONTROL
CABINET PANELS.
2. Remove 4 nuts retaining controller.
3. Remove electrical leads from controller.
4. Loose control dial set screw and remove dial.
5. Remove controller.
6. Replace in reverse order.
To Calibrate:
(classic controls only, if required)
1. Fill the pan with unused oil to the indicated mark. Place a thermocouple 25
mm below the oil surface in the middle of the pan.
2. Light the unit and allow the oil to heat.
3. Temperature should settle at 374ºF(±9ºF), 190ºC (±5ºC). If adjustment is
required, disconnect main power. Adjustment is located on the back of the
control board. Turn adjustment counter-clockwise to increase temperature
and clockwise to decrease.
REMOVAL OF PRESSURE SWITCH (TURN THE GAS & ELECTRICITY MAINS OFF)
Water Level
Sensor
Pressure Switch
1. Remove panel from base of kettle by undoing the retaining screws.
2. Disconnect the electrical leads from the pressure switch.
3. Drain kettle by tilting kettle slightly and undoing the compression fitting at
the pressure switch. Allow kettle to drain into a suitably sized container.
4. Remove and withdraw the pressure switch from the kettle base by undoing
the compression fitting.
5. Replace in reverse order.
6. Once the pressure switch is in place, the kettle jacket should be refilled.
Always refer to wiring diagram when reconnecting electrical leads.
REMOVAL OF LOW WATER LEVEL SENSOR (TURN GAS & ELECTRICITY MAINS
OFF)
1. Remove panel from base of kettle by undoing the retaining screws.
2. Disconnect the electrical leads from the water sensor.
3. Drain the kettle by tilting it slightly and undoing the low water level sensor.
Allow the kettle to drain into a suitably sized container.
4. Remove the low water sensor from the kettle base.
5. Replace in reverse order.
6. Ensure a suitable sealant is used to seal the low water level sensor Boss.
7. When the low water level sensor is in place, the jacket should be filled.
REMOVAL OF BURNERS (TURN THE GAS & ELECTRICITY MAINS OFF)
1. Remove water splash guards around the burner.
2. Undo compression fitting at gas pipe to burner manifold and to the pilot.
3. Disconnect electrical leads to the pilot.
4. Remove the four retaining nuts securing the burner and igniter assembly
to the combustion chamber. Carefully support the weight of the burner
manifold and lower the assembly to a safe position.
5. The burners are now accessible and can be removed as required. Ensure
adequate sealant is used to seal the burners.
6. Replace in reverse order. Always check for gas soundness when any part of
the gas circuit has been disturbed.
REMOVAL OF PILOT (TURN THE GAS & ELECTRICITY MAINS OFF)
1. Remove water splash guards around the burner.
2. Disconnect the high voltage spark cable from the pilot.
3. Disconnect the ground connection cable from the pilot mounting screw.
4. Remove the second pilot mounting screw.
5. Remove pilot assembly and install new pilot.
6. Replace in reverse order.
7. Ensure that there is an adequate spark at the sparking electrode and that
the burners light smoothly and without delay.
8. As the burners ignite, ensure that the sparking sequence stops and that the
burners remain lit.

3.17
Removal of Pressure Gauge (Turn the
gas and electricity mains off)
a) Using the correctly sized spanner remove
the pressure gauge from top of the sight
glass.
b) Replace with new pressure gauge ensuring
that an adequate sealing compound is used.
c) Once the pressure gauge has been
replaced, the kettle jacket will require
venting. (Para 3.2)
3.18
Removal of Sight Glass (Turn the gas
and electricity mains off)
a) Remove sight glass protection bars.
b) Undo top and bottom compression fittings.
c) Allow the water in the sight glass to drain.
d) Remove the sight glass.
e) Replace in reverse order.
